kami fe0e654ab1 Ask the question, then act on the answer
On a clarify decision with one identifiable gap she now asks instead of saying
"не поняла", and parks the request. The next utterance is parsed as the answer
with the router's own extractor and the completed decision runs through
applyAction like any other — so a clarified act still needs the allowlist and
still hits the destructive confirm gate. An answer that does not fill the gap
drops the request; she never asks twice. Also pulls the session-store block
that HandlePushToTalk and handleText both had into rememberTurn, since the
clarify path needed a third copy.

kami a54ebac0cb Work out which slot is missing and phrase one short question
A table per intent (reminder needs a time, fact needs a key, act needs a fn)
plus one fixed Russian question per slot. Templates, not model output: a 0.8B
would wander and a question that rewords itself is harder to answer. Note,
query, chat and system get no question — for those a clarify decision keeps
the canned reply rather than inventing a question for noise.

// clarifyTTL — how long a parked question stays answerable. Same 90s as the
// confirm gate, for the same reason: an answer is a same-breath gesture, and a
// stale question must not eat an unrelated later utterance.
const clarifyTTL = 90 * time.Second
// wantedSlots — what each intent needs before she can act on it. First entry is
// the one she asks about; the rest are only used to decide act-vs-drop.
//
// Intents not listed here are never worth a question: note and query act on the
// raw utterance, chat and system have nothing to fill in. For those a clarify
// decision keeps the canned "не поняла" reply — inventing a question for noise
// is worse than admitting she missed it.
var wantedSlots = map[router.Intent][]dialogue.Slot{
router.IntentReminder: {dialogue.SlotTime},
router.IntentFact: {dialogue.SlotKey},
router.IntentAct: {dialogue.SlotFn},
}
// clarifyQuestions — one short question per missing slot.
//
// These are fixed templates, not model output. The resident model is a 0.8B; it
// would wander, and a question whose wording changes every time is harder to
// answer than a blunt one that always reads the same. They are infinitive
// questions, so there is no gender agreement to get wrong; the feminine
// self-reference lives in the reply she gives when she drops the request.
var clarifyQuestions = map[dialogue.Slot]string{
dialogue.SlotTime: "На когда напомнить?",
dialogue.SlotKey: "Что записать?",
dialogue.SlotFn: "Что сделать?",
}
// clarifyDropped — she asked once, the answer still did not fill the gap, so
// the request is gone. Said plainly, once, with no second question.
const clarifyDropped = "Не разобрала — скажи целиком, пожалуйста."
// missingFor returns the slots a decision still needs, most important first.
// Empty ⇒ there is nothing identifiable to ask about.
func missingFor(dec router.Decision) []dialogue.Slot {
return dialogue.StillMissing(wantedSlots[dec.Intent], toDialogueSlots(dec.Slots))
}
// clarifyQuestion picks the one question to ask for a clarify decision. Returns
// ("", false) when she has no idea what is missing.
//
// One question about one thing: if two slots are missing she asks about the
// first and lets the rest go. Two questions in a row is an interrogation.
func clarifyQuestion(dec router.Decision) (dialogue.Slot, string, bool) {
missing := missingFor(dec)
if len(missing) == 0 {
return "", "", false
}
q, ok := clarifyQuestions[missing[0]]
if !ok {
return "", "", false
}
return missing[0], q, true
}
// askClarify parks the request and returns the question to ask instead of the
// canned "не поняла". Returns ("", false) when there is nothing to ask about, so
// the caller falls back to the canned reply.
func (h *reactiveHandler) askClarify(dec router.Decision) (string, bool) {
if h.clarifyStore == nil {
return "", false
}
slot, question, ok := clarifyQuestion(dec)
if !ok {
return "", false
}
h.clarifyStore.Put(voiceDialogueID, &dialogue.PendingQuestion{
Intent: dialogue.Intent(dec.Intent),
Slots: toDialogueSlots(dec.Slots),
Missing: []dialogue.Slot{slot},
Utterance: dec.Utterance,
Asked: h.now(),
TTL: clarifyTTL,
Attempts: 1, // asked once; MaxAttempts is 1, so there is no second ask
})
log.Printf("voice: clarify — asked about %s for intent=%s", slot, dec.Intent)
return question, true
}
// resolveClarifyAnswer reads an utterance as the answer to a parked question.
// Returns ("", false) when no live question is parked (or it expired), so the
// caller routes the utterance normally as a fresh request. Sibling of
// resolveConfirm and checked in the same place.
//
// The answer is parsed with the same extractor the router uses, for the intent
// she parked — no second parser. If it still does not fill the gap the request
// is dropped: she does not ask again.
func (h *reactiveHandler) resolveClarifyAnswer(ctx context.Context, text string) (string, bool) {
if h.clarifyStore == nil {
return "", false
}
q := h.clarifyStore.Get(voiceDialogueID, h.now())
if q == nil {
return "", false
}
// One shot either way: the question is consumed whether or not the answer
// works, so a failed answer can't leave the question armed.
h.clarifyStore.Delete(voiceDialogueID)
intent := router.Intent(q.Intent)
answer := h.extractor.Extract(ctx, intent, text, h.now())
merged := q.Answer(text, toDialogueSlots(answer))
if len(dialogue.StillMissing(q.Missing, merged)) > 0 {
log.Printf("voice: clarify — answer %q did not fill %v, dropping", text, q.Missing)
return clarifyDropped, true
}
// Rebuild the decision as if it had routed cleanly, then run it down the
// normal path. Clarify is deliberately false and the intent is unchanged:
// filling in an argument never grants authority, so the completed decision
// still meets the allowlist and the destructive-act confirm gate in
// applyAction exactly like any other decision.
dec := router.Decision{
Utterance: q.Utterance,
Stage: 2,
Intent: intent,
Slots: applyDialogueSlots(answer, merged),
}
return h.finishClarified(ctx, dec), true
}
// finishClarified runs a completed decision through the same steps a freshly
// routed one takes: remember the turn, act, then phrase.
func (h *reactiveHandler) finishClarified(ctx context.Context, dec router.Decision) string {
if h.dialogueSessions != nil {
now := h.now()
prev := h.dialogueSessions.Get(voiceDialogueID, now)
dec = followUpMerge(prev, dec, now)
h.rememberTurn(prev, dec, now)
}
reply := h.applyAction(ctx, dec)
if reply == "" {
reply = h.replier.Reply(dec)
}
return reply
}
// rememberTurn stores this turn as the dialogue session the next follow-up
// inherits from, carrying up to 4 prior turns of history for anaphora. Capped so
// one long conversation can't grow the session unboundedly.
func (h *reactiveHandler) rememberTurn(prev *dialogue.Session, dec router.Decision, now time.Time) {
var history []dialogue.Turn
if prev != nil {
history = append(history, dialogue.Turn{
Intent: prev.Intent,
Slots: prev.Slots,
Text: prev.Slots.Text,
})
maxHist := len(prev.History)
if maxHist > 3 {
maxHist = 3
}
history = append(history, prev.History[:maxHist]...)
}
ttl := time.Duration(0) // use the store default (2 min)
if dec.Intent == router.IntentChat {
ttl = 15 * time.Minute // conversational turns should last longer
}
h.dialogueSessions.Put(voiceDialogueID, &dialogue.Session{
Intent: dialogue.Intent(dec.Intent),
Slots: toDialogueSlots(dec.Slots),
Timestamp: now,
TTL: ttl,
History: history,
})
}
